TombstoneUtils.Config.BacktraceFilterPattern

public static class TombstoneUtils.Config.BacktraceFilterPattern
extends Object

java.lang.Объект
com.android.sts.common.util.TombstoneUtils.Config.BacktraceFilterPattern


Служебный класс, содержащий шаблоны для фильтрации обратных трассировок.

Фильтр соответствует, если какой-либо кадр обратной трассировки соответствует какому-либо шаблону.

Либо filenamePattern, либо MethodPattern может иметь значение null, и в этом случае он будет действовать как шаблон подстановочного знака и соответствовать чему угодно.

Нулевое имя файла или имя метода не будет соответствовать ни одному непустому шаблону.

Краткое содержание

Общественные конструкторы

BacktraceFilterPattern (String filenamePattern, String methodPattern)

Создает BacktraceFilterPattern с заданными шаблонами имен файлов и методов.

Публичные методы

boolean match (TombstoneProtos.BacktraceFrame frame)

Возвращает true, если текущие шаблоны соответствуют кадру обратной трассировки.

Общественные конструкторы

BacktraceFilterPattern

public BacktraceFilterPattern (String filenamePattern, 
                String methodPattern)

Создает BacktraceFilterPattern с заданными шаблонами имен файлов и методов.

Нулевые шаблоны интерпретируются как подстановочные знаки и соответствуют чему угодно.

Параметры
filenamePattern String : строка регулярного выражения для шаблона имени файла. Может быть нулевым.

methodPattern String : строка регулярного выражения для шаблона имени метода. Может быть нулевым.

Публичные методы

соответствовать

public boolean match (TombstoneProtos.BacktraceFrame frame)

Возвращает true, если текущие шаблоны соответствуют кадру обратной трассировки.

Параметры
frame TombstoneProtos.BacktraceFrame

Возврат
boolean